Synaptipy is a cross-platform, open-source electrophysiology visualisation and analysis suite.
The primary focus is whole-cell patch-clamp and intracellular recordings; however, any
electrophysiology signal whose file format is supported by the
`Neo <https://neo.readthedocs.io/en/latest/>`_ I/O library can be loaded, visualised, and processed
- including extracellular and multi-channel recordings.

Built on Python and Qt6, Synaptipy provides OpenGL-accelerated signal visualisation,
15 built-in analysis modules spanning intrinsic membrane properties, action potential
characterisation, synaptic event detection, and optogenetics, a composable batch processing
engine, and an extensible plugin interface that allows custom analysis routines to be
integrated without modifying the core package. Three example plugins ship with
the application and are loadable via a single checkbox in Preferences.
File I/O is handled through
`Neo <https://neo.readthedocs.io/en/latest/>`_, supporting over 30 acquisition formats including
Axon ABF, WinWCP, CED/Spike2, Intan, Igor Pro, NWB, Open Ephys, and more.
NWB export is provided via `PyNWB <https://pynwb.readthedocs.io/en/stable/>`_.
